The CQUniversity Cairns Taipans New Year's Eve game will go ahead, the NBL has confirmed today.
However, the opponent will change from the New Zealand Breakers to the Perth Wildcats on Friday 31 December. Tip-off remains 7:00pm AEST at the Cairns Convention Centre. Click HERE for tickets.
The NBL continues to follow the advice of governments and health authorities and has made the change in line with its Covid health and safety protocols.
Regular testing of all players and staff will continue, while further testing will be carried out on individuals impacted or those deemed close contacts.
